    Groove is the operative word. Just learning the shuffle is one thing. (shuffles I should say, there are many) Putting it where it belongs is another. Learn to play behind the beat. That is easier said than done. Develop your sense of time. It is so easy to thin out the groove by playing right on top of the beat. It may take you a lifetime to get that groove right. Listen to the great shuffle players. See how they bring the delay? They make the groove nice and fat. They are not pushin it, pullin it, or imposing themselves upon it.
    Ok, now go do that.
